Action item: The Relayn deploy-status bot silently dropped updates when the pipeline API paginated results, so responders believed a rollback had completed when it had not. We will add pagination handling, a staleness banner, and an integration test. Until merged, verify deploy state directly in the pipeline console, documented at the page below.

runbook for kahop-kajop: https://rundeck.ordinio.test/display/secrets/pipeline/issue/pages/repo/browse/e5732776e07d1285107e5aeb

Welcome to the Bramblefork assignment service, which hands out A/B experiment buckets for all Tessira storefront surfaces. Before reviewing changes, run the service locally: copy env.sample to .env, set ASSIGN_PORT=8710 and EXPERIMENT_SOURCE=local, and seed the fixture experiments with `make seed`. Bucket hashes are salted so assignments stay stable across restarts, and the salt must match staging exactly. Add the salt to your .env on the next line.

env line for fawip-fajef: COURIER_KEY13=6b302cb20dc80

## Step 3: Import the Legacy Catalogue

Run the Bookspindle import tool against the exported catalogue file from the old system. Records with missing shelf codes are quarantined, not dropped, so reassure patrons that nothing is lost. Expect the full import to take roughly two hours. Start the importer with the following configuration values.

deployment values, faduf-tawep:
SORDOR_LOG_LEVEL=error
SORDOR_METRICS_HOST=metrics.sordor.nelvrolabs.internal
SORDOR_POOL_SIZE=4

RUNBOOK 4.2 — Medical-cooler transport, Saltmere field clinic

Coolers are packed in cold store C with fresh gel packs no earlier than two hours before departure. Shift lead verifies temperature strip, seals the lid, and logs the departure time. Transit window is six hours maximum. At the clinic, the courier follows the hand-over instruction below.

dispatch memo: the lamwyn fenwyn courier leaves the wenir ledger at gate 7175 under passcode 822969